Definitions

  • the invention is a device for adjusting corner protective strips for the plaster in the area of the window reveals.
  • a device which according to the invention consists of a trolley which has two rollers arranged one behind the other on the side, the bottom of which is provided with wheels, and the one holding device carries, from an angularly displaceable and fixable arranged angular part, which is formed from two mutually perpendicular rods, and from an angular, movable on the holding device and clampable teaching with two legs enclosing an angle of 80 to 100 degrees.
  • This device allows problem-free and quick adjustment of corner protection strips even by inexperienced forces. Provided that the window reveals in a building are of the same design in most cases, all corner protection strips can be adjusted quickly and precisely with the once set device.
  • the setting and fixing of the angle part and the teaching of the device according to the given structural dimensions is infinitely possible and it can be easily accomplished.
  • the trolley is expediently formed from a rectangular frame. This measure allows the simple manufacture of a trolley of relatively low weight.
  • the floor carries two pairs of wheels, one behind the other, whose axis of rotation is perpendicular to the axes of rotation of the rollers.
  • the arrangement of four wheels ensures that the trolley runs smoothly and smoothly when it is moved.
  • the frame forming the base is advantageously composed of four angle profiles, which enables inexpensive production.
  • the holding device consists of at least two square tubes lying next to one another. This measure enables simple adjustment of the angle part.
  • Each square tube expediently has a thread into which a wing screw is screwed. So that the angle part can be clamped in the desired position in the desired position on the holding device.
  • one leg of the teaching is formed by a tube of square cross section, which is telescopically arranged on the other rod of the angle part.
  • a screw thread, into which a set screw is screwed, is expediently located on the leg of the gauge. This allows the gauge to be clamped in place.
  • a level indicator can be arranged on the trolley to check the movements of the trolley.
  • the rollers and the wheels can have rubber treads.
  • the drawing shows the device in a perspective view in the use position, applied to a window frame.
  • the proposed implement consists essentially of a trolley 1, an angle part 2 and a gauge 3.
  • the trolley 1 which is formed by a rectangular frame 4 composed of steel angle profiles, has two rollers 6 arranged one behind the other on its one side 5 and two pairs of wheels 8 likewise arranged one behind the other on its base 7.
  • the axes of rotation 9 of the rollers 6 are perpendicular to the axes of rotation 10 of the wheels. Both the rollers 6 and the wheels 8 have treads made of rubber or a rubber-like plastic. A dragonfly is arranged on the top 11 of the trolley 1.
  • the trolley 1 carries a holding device 13, which consists of three closely spaced and interconnected square tubes 14 made of steel. These square tubes 14 are attached to two opposite sides of the frame 4 so that a right angle is formed between them and the frame 4 and they are perpendicular to the side carrying the rollers 6. The length of the square tubes 14 corresponds to the width of the frame 4 of the trolley 1.
  • Each of the three square tubes 14 has a thread 15 into which a wing nut 16 is screwed. These threads 15 are each part of a screw nut fastened on the square tube 14 concerned.
  • the angle part 2 is formed from two rods 17 and 18 which are at right angles to one another and which are square tubes made of steel.
  • One (17) of these rods is telescopically displaceable in the middle of the three square tubes 14 and can be locked there with the wing nut 16, so that the angle part 2 can no longer move relative to the trolley 1.
  • the other rod 18 is at right angles to the outside in the plane of the three square tubes 14.
  • the gauge 3 is slidably and clampably arranged.
  • This gauge 3 has two legs 19 and 20 enclosing an angle of slightly less than 90 degrees.
  • One leg 19 of the teaching 3 consists of a piece of a flat band made of steel, while the second leg 20 is formed by a tube of square cross section made of steel, which is telescopically arranged on the other rod 18 of the angle part 2.
  • the described device is handled as follows.
  • the corner protective strip 26 to be adjusted is attached and attached with mortar in at least two places.
  • the device has previously been adjusted accordingly by inserting a rod 17 of the angle part 2 into one of the three square tubes 14 of the holding device 13, taking into account the depth of the window frame 27, and provisionally fixing it there with the aid of the associated wing nut 16.
  • the trolley 1 with its wheels 8 is placed on the glass pane of the window 26 and the rollers 6 are brought into contact with the inner surface of the window frame 27 and pressed there.
  • the gauge 3 is moved on the rod 18 until the corner protective strip 26 lies between the two legs 19 and 20 of the gauge.
  • the required positions are found by moving the angle part 2 and the gauge 3, then the angle part 2 and the gauge 3 are finally clamped by tightening the wing nut 16 and the set screw 22.
  • the trolley 1 can now be moved up and down along the window frame 27, the gauge 3 automatically being guided along the corner protective strip 26.
  • the corner protective strip 26 is adjusted and adjusted in relation to the window frame 27, the reveal 24 and the wall.
  • the adjusted corner protection strip 26 finally attached to the wall with additional mortar, so that after its setting, the reveal 24 and the adjoining wall can be plastered in the usual way.

Claims (11)

  1. Dispositif pour ajuster des baguettes de protection d'angle pour l'enduit dans la zone d'embrasures de fenêtres, avec un chariot roulant (1), qui présente sur le côté (5) deux rouleaux (6) disposés l'un derrière l'autre, dont le fond (7) est muni de roues (8), et qui supporte un dispositif de fixation (13), avec une pièce d'équerre (2), disposée avec une possibilité de déplacement et de fixation sur le dispositif (13), et formée de deux barres (17 et 18) perpendiculaires entre elles, et avec un calibre (3) angulaire, muni de deux branches (19 et 20) formant entre elles un angle de 80 à 100°, qui peut se déplacer et être bloqué sur le dispositif de fixation (13).
  2. Dispositif suivant la revendication 1, caractérisé en ce que le chariot roulant (1) est formé d'un cadre rectangulaire (4).
  3. Dispositif suivant l'une des revendications 1 et 2, caractérisé en ce que le fond (7) supporte deux paires de roues (8), prévues l'une derrière l'autre, et dont les axes de rotation (10) se situent à la perpendiculaire des axes de rotation (9) des rouleaux (6).
  4. Dispositif suivant l'une des revendications 2 et 3, caractérisé en ce que le cadre (4), formant le fond (7), se compose de quatre cornières.
  5. Dispositif suivant l'une quelconque des revendications 1 à 4, caractérisé en ce que le dispositif de fixation (13) se compose de deux tubes carrés (14), au moins, juxtaposés.
  6. Dispositif suivant la revendication 5, caractérisé en ce que chaque tube carré (14) supporte un taraudage (15), dans lequel est posée une vis à oreilles (16).
  7. Dispositif suivant l'une quelconque des revendications 1 à 6, caractérisé en ce que les barres (17 et 18) de la pièce d'équerre (2) sont des tubes carrés, et en ce qu'une barre (17) est disposée avec une possibilité de déplacement télescopique dans l'un des tubes carrés (14) du dispositif de fixation (13), et peut être fixée par la vis à oreilles (16).
  8. Dispositif suivant l'une quelconque des revendications 1 à 7, caractérisé en ce que l'une des branches (20) du calibre (3) est formée par un tube de section transversale carrée, disposé avec une possibilité de déplacement télescopique sur l'autre barre (18) de la pièce d'équerre (2).
  9. Dispositif suivant l'une quelconque des revendications 1 à 8, caractérisé en ce que la branche (20) du calibre (3) supporte un filet de vis (21), dans lequel est posée une vis de réglage (22).
  10. Dispositif suivant l'une quelconque des revendications 1 à 9, caractérisé en ce qu'une nivelle (12) est disposée sur le chariot roulant (1).
  11. Dispositif suivant l'une quelconque des revendications 1 à 10, caractérisé en ce que les rouleaux (6) et les roues (8) présentent des surfaces de roulement en caoutchouc.
